Four top-10 teams in the statewide girls basketball rankings square off this week on MHSAA.tv.

On Tuesday, the top-ranked team in Class A, Saginaw Heritage, played at seventh-ranked Midland Dow at 7 p.m.; and the No. 7 team in Class B, Houghton, traveled across the Portage Canal Lift Bridge to face the top-ranked team in Class C, Calumet. Replays of both games can been seen on MHSAA.tv, produced by Midland Dow and Calumet High School students involved in the MHSAA’s School Broadcast Program.

In its seventh year, the School Broadcast Program gives members an opportunity to showcase excellence in their schools by creating video programming of athletic and non-athletic events with students gaining skills in announcing, camera operation, directing/producing and graphics. 

The program also gives schools the opportunity to raise money through advertising and viewing subscriptions.  

All sporting events – Live or On-Demand – are available on a subscription basis only for their first 72 hours online. They become available for free, on-demand viewing approximately 72 hours following their completion.
